    With over 60 years of combined turbocharger development and racing experience, we at Precision Turbo take great pride in providing you with the best external wastegate on the market today. The PW39 is made from high grade, high temperature stainless steel and billet aluminum components. It features our own purpose designed Kevlar reinforced wastegate diaphragm and a 347 stainless investment cast valve body. Our investment cast valve body has a smooth internal surface, giving you better flow and more accurate boost control. Our PW39 was designed to be a direct replacement for other existing 44mm wastegate flanges, but will work best with the flange provided. The PW39 features a Nickel Chromium Alloy valve and 5 different 17-7 precipitation hardened springs. Also included are stainless steel inlet and outlet flanges with clamps. With a satin black anodized, 6061 aluminum billet wastegate cap you will have years of good looks and protection from the elements. The PW39 is generally compatible with most aftermarket manual and electronic boost controllers on the market today.

    Pricing is listed below for the journal bearing turbos, generally upgrading to the ceramic ball bearing center section is $450, this is available in the drop down menu. Keep in mind these turbos use a ceramic ball bearing CHRA, which does not require a water jacket, ie water cooling, so you save on water lines and have a cleaner engine bay. Currently we have a range on order for stock including a HP6765SP-B (S refers to S compressor housing 4" inlet 2.5" outlet, P refers to ported shroud compressor housing, -B refers to ceramic ball bearing).

    Quote, originally posted by ejg3855 »
    where can i get compressor maps, I cannot find them on their site.

    Looking for something comparable to a 3071R, have heard these spool better?


    They don't post compressor maps, they spool very well compared to a comparable sized Garrett. There are a variety of sizes, we have a 5857, 6262, 6557, and a 6057 on the way. They're all billet

    They also have full vband housings available upon request, but their flanges are proprietary and not compatible with TiAL, 2 housing sizes, 82 and 64 I believe.
